Output e32dc35cbd5c840ebefd576a6736745d1df0acafdb648c538c1536d63e3681a2:9

value
2406000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c5b4c2e9abc528f815c9fd0aa69986c89a06d2 OP_EQUAL
address
3Ju9oU8AZqDpCNK378iVdmNZLXGXLV3Sx3
transaction
e32dc35cbd5c840ebefd576a6736745d1df0acafdb648c538c1536d63e3681a2
spent
true